Output 5138151405f488d3d111e8dfdb3d05f5e2da7a72e2ee49f5aa5c52632522c908:4

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d4828603b8af9f1c58a6b730020205eeeefc6f OP_EQUAL
address
3Ecwn31yqHfPRnPvDFTnSd3oWQtBCaApbB
transaction
5138151405f488d3d111e8dfdb3d05f5e2da7a72e2ee49f5aa5c52632522c908
confirmations
511668
spent
true